Output 6590a957dee08bf2901c09c5f627e28f53f6447accecf7b43e0dcc01e22860bb:3
- value
- 50964
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d61f0b1db736e204fbe85baa7b59df3bd0d15d1 OP_EQUAL
- address
- 3MsaawgeabU45ogq1kHEuBEZEBqe1287hH
- transaction
- 6590a957dee08bf2901c09c5f627e28f53f6447accecf7b43e0dcc01e22860bb
- confirmations
- 126764
- spent
- true